Danse MacabreView game page

Escape from the catacomb as a group of ever dancing skeletons!

Great concept and execution!  I think having a way to switch between clockwise and anticlockwise and/or being able to change the next pivot skeleton would have made the gameplay easier, especially when getting stuck on a wall.  Overall, I really wanted to join the (g)rave myself!

Developer (1 edit) (+1)

We had the option to switch in one direction or another at the start, and it felt not good enough. Basically it allowed "spider movement" that really didn't fit what we wanted to create.
